The Arkansas River Basin Water Forum gave Bud O’Hara, water resources division manager for the Pueblo Board of Water Works, the Bob Appel Friend of the Arkansas River Award at its annual meeting.

“He has walked this basin literally from top to bottom and even across the Continental Divide where an important part of the water in this basin is imported from,” said Phil Reynolds, a Southeastern Colorado Water Conservancy District project manager, in presenting the award. The forum annually recognizes a person who has made contributions to the river with the award, which is named for one of the forum’s founders. Past winners are Allen Ringle, Carl Genova, Reed Dils, Paul Flack, Denzel Goodwin and Paul Conlin.

O’Hara was surprised by the award, having been convinced to attend the meeting at the last minute by his boss, Executive Director Alan Hamel. “I really appreciate this. Gracious, heavens,” O’Hara said. “Really, it’s been Alan who has given me the freedom to do things for the water board.”
